  1. "Hallelujah, I'm a Bum" (Roud 7992) is an American folk song, that responds with humorous sarcasm to unhelpful moralizing about the circumstance of being a hobo. " Hallelujah! I'm A Bum " Was the Marching Song of the IWW . [1] (
